Legal use of the esignature licitness for engineering in Canada
The legal use of the esignature licitness for engineering in Canada is anchored in various statutes, including the Electronic Transactions Act and the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act. These laws establish the framework for the validity of electronic signatures, ensuring they are recognized in legal proceedings. To be legally binding, the eSignature must be created with the intent to sign, be linked to the signatory, and be capable of identifying the signer. Key elements of the esignature licitness for engineering in Canada
Key elements that define the esignature licitness for engineering in Canada include:
- Intent to Sign: The signer must demonstrate a clear intention to sign the document electronically.
- Authentication: The identity of the signer must be verifiable to prevent fraud.
- Integrity of the Document: The document must remain unchanged after signing to maintain its validity.
- Consent: All parties involved must consent to use electronic signatures.
